Did the first T20 International happen? This would be the reaction of most Bangladesh fans as the home side was brutally blown away by the Windies who prefer to play the shortest format more. It got over ever so quickly with Shai Hope continuing his purple patch with the bat while Keemo Paul was a surprise package who tonked the ball like anything to gun down the total.

The visitors endured a near perfect game in Sylhet and they will be concluding their tough tour in Dhaka with the last two T20Is set to take place at the Shere Bangla National Stadium. They haven’t been consistent in this format and broke the five-match losing streak in the previous game. This is the best chance for them to seal the series after such an authoritative performance.

Bangladesh, on the other hand, put up an abject batting performance in the series opener. Only three of their batsmen reached double figures and all of them got out by playing atrocious strokes. Shakib Al Hasan was disappointed in the post-match presentation when asked about the same. He was the lone warrior for them scoring 61 runs but nobody lent any support and his frustration was understandable.

Pitch and Conditions

The pitch at the Shere Bangla National Stadium is known to produce turning pitches. Having said that, the teams bowling first have won 20 out of 37 matches at this venue and that might prompt the team winning the toss to field first. With an evening start to the game, the dew might also come into play. The conditions will be extremely good with no chances of rain with the temperatures dropping into the late 10s.

Team Combinations

Bangladesh

Bangladesh might guard against a plethora of changes after a solitary loss. But Mehidy Hasan might get dropped after the way he was taken apart in the first match. The left-arm spinner Nazmul Islam is likely to come in his place while the rest of the line-up will remain the same. The batsmen should take up more responsibility instead of playing too many shots early in their innings.

Probable XI: Tamim Iqbal, Liton Das, Soumya Sarkar, Shakib Al Hasan (C), Mushfiqur Rahim (wk), Mahmudullah, Ariful Haque, Mohammad Saifuddin, Nazmul Islam, Abu Hider Rony, Mustafizur Rahman.

Windies

There is no change for the Windies to change the winning combination. It was a splendid effort from them and the skipper Carlos Brathwaite, who will be delighted after getting such a huge bid in the IPL auction, will hope that they just continue the good work. Shai Hope continues to be the threat for the hosts while the likes of Evin Lewis, Nicholas Pooran and Shimron Hetmyer are also some of the best players in the format.

Probable XI: Evin Lewis, Shai Hope (wk), Nicholas Pooran, Shimron Hetmyer, Darren Bravo, Rovman Powell, Carlos Brathwaite (C), Fabian Allen, Sheldon Cottrell, Fabian Allen, Keemo Paul, Oshane Thomas.
